Sudoku Revolution 2: A New Twist on Sudoku
Sudoku Revolution 2 is a game that brings new rules to the traditional Sudoku game. Developed by Stanley Lam, this puzzle game offers several diverse variations of Sudoku puzzles that are sure to give you hours of fun. In addition to the normal mode, Sudoku Revolution 2 includes six other modes: Anti Diagonal, Consecutive, Non-Consecutive, Argyle, Anti-King, and Anti-Knight.
The basic rule of Sudoku Revolution 2 is to fill numbers in the board such that every row, column, and region contains one occurrence of each number. Each mode is divided into four difficulty levels, and there are 200 levels for each mode. You can play through hundreds of levels for free. The game also includes features such as "Hint," which auto-fills the board with memo that has no direct conflicts with other numbers, and autosave, which saves your progress on unfinished levels. You can also record your best completion time for each level.
